Klas Flärdh
About
Klas Flärdh has authored 56 papers that have received a total of 3.3k indexed citations.
This includes 38 papers in Molecular Biology, 29 papers in Pharmacology and 26 papers in Genetics. The topics of these papers are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(29 papers), Bacterial Genetics and Biotechnology (26 papers) and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(19 papers). Klas Flärdh is often cited by papers focused on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(29 papers), Bacterial Genetics and Biotechnology (26 papers) and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(19 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, United Kingdom and United States. Klas Flärdh's co-authors include Mark J. Buttner, Linda Sandblad, Antje M. Hempel, Nora Ausmees and Nina Grantcharova and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Nature Reviews Microbiology.
